He sent everything disassembled. I have a circuit board that I believes controls the print functions and a Power supply. On the board I have figured out how to wire the stepping motor and the limit switches on each end of the slider. but don't know how the board connects to the printer or where the power supply connects to the printer. I am posting an image of the board as it sits now and one close up of the board.
the 4 black wires in the corner control stop and single pass, but I don't know where to connect them. In the opposite corner there is a Red, Yellow and Black wire marked A Gnd and B. don't know what they connect to and in the middle on left beneath the four black wires are two black wires marked PE and A3 on the board that I have no idea about.

My shot in the dark guess would be.

A = Encoder A signal from epson
B = Encoder B signal from Epson
GND = from Epson

Those can be found on the backside of the encoder wheel sensor. It's a pain to have to solder those and figure out what is what.

PE = would pe the Paper trigger sensor. I'd guess use A3 since that is the size of the printer.
